Can a labour lawyer in Dubai assist with disputes over annual leave entitlements?

 Yes, labour lawyers in Dubai can be incredibly helpful when it comes to disputes over annual leave entitlements. The UAE Labour Law provides clear guidelines regarding the rights of employees to annual leave, and a labour lawyer can help ensure that these rights are upheld and respected.

Under the UAE Labour Law, employees are entitled to a minimum of 30 calendar days of annual leave after completing one year of continuous service with their employer. For those who have been employed for less than a year, the entitlement is calculated on a pro-rata basis. However, disputes may arise over various aspects of annual leave, such as the calculation of leave days, approval or rejection of leave requests, leave carryover policies, and the payment for unused leave days.

In such cases, labour lawyers Dubai can assist in a number of ways. They can provide expert legal advice to both employees and employers about their rights and obligations under the law. This is particularly important for employees who may not be familiar with their legal entitlements or employers who may not be fully compliant with the labour regulations. A labour lawyer can help clarify complex issues, such as the appropriate procedures for applying for leave or the payment structure for unused leave at the end of employment.

If a dispute arises, a labour lawyer can represent their client in negotiations or, if necessary, escalate the matter to the UAE's Labour Court. Labour lawyers in Dubai are skilled in navigating the UAE’s legal system and can advocate on behalf of employees to ensure that their entitlements, including annual leave, are respected.
